What is Hepatitis B?
Hepatitis B is a viral infection that targets the liver and is spread through contact with infected blood or bodily fluids. It's a global health concern with high prevalence in parts of Asia, Africa, Eastern Europe, and the Middle East. The virus can cause both acute and chronic liver disease, cirrhosis, liver failure, or liver cancer. While symptoms may be mild or absent at first, long-term carriers can unknowingly transmit the infection.
Travel-Focused Vaccine Information
The Hepatitis B vaccine is recommended for travellers to regions with high or intermediate prevalence, especially those likely to have close contact with local communities or healthcare environments. The standard course is 3 injections over 6 months, but a rapid schedule (0, 7, and 21 days) is also available for last-minute travel. Full immunity typically develops after the second or third dose.

Symptoms of Hepatitis B
Fatigue and weakness
Fever and nausea
Dark urine and pale stools
Abdominal pain (especially near the liver)
Loss of appetite
Joint pain
Jaundice (yellowing of the skin or eyes)

Potential Side Effects of Hepatitis B vaccine
Soreness or redness at injection site
Mild headache or fever
Fatigue
Joint or muscle aches
Nausea or dizziness
Severe allergic reactions are rare.
